New Knitting Bag

After some trial and error I think I have found the knitting project bag I like the most, either the Field Bag or Town Bag. I have discovered I like a drawstring bag and really do not care if I have a zippered pocket. I try to keep zippers away from my yarn (I have been called many things and graceful/coordinated is never one of them). Of course milage may vary from person to person, but those bags are the ones I reach for over and over again.

A Field bag will hold your smaller projects and a Town Bag is big enough for a sweater. I keep a small tin in each bag filled with stitch markers and foldable scissors. A measuring tape rounds out all the tools I usually need. If required I can sneak in try on cords.

I bought Smokey the Bear fabric from Purpleseamstress Fabric quite a few months ago. I purchased it with the idea of making a knitting bag. It finally occurred last weekend. I had enough to make the Town Bag.

I think it turned out quite nice. It already has my Garden Bee crochet purse pieces inside ready for me to work away.
